Home Remodeling
Green Building Guidelines
JANUARY 2004 Edition
The Home Remodeling Green Building Guidelines are designed for professional contractors and homeowners. The Guidelines offer:
- Cost-effective suggestions to minimize construction-related waste, create healthier and more durable homes, reduce operating costs for homeowners and support local manufacturers and suppliers of resource-efficient building materials.
- Methods to reduce the impacts of building in Alameda County communities; including solid waste management, water conservation, energy efficiency and resource conservation.
The practices contained in these Guidelines were selected for their viability in today’s market and their ability to promote sustainable building. Contractors using this booklet will differentiate themselves in the marketplace while protecting our environment.
The Guidelines were developed through a partnership among local developers, architects, contractors, green building experts and staff of the Alameda County Waste Management Authority and Recycling Board .
